   A sitz bath is especially beneficial for women because it's a gentle way to treat a variety of female health issues. The reason why sitz baths are so effective for such a wide range of issues is that the simple act of sitting in warm water actually helps to neutralize inflammation. This can create instant reductions in pain and swelling in a localized area. 

How Do You Take a Sitz Bath?

   A sitz bath is actually an incredibly simple concept. It only requires you to dip everything below your hips in a shallow basin of lukewarm water. Some people choose to add Epsom salt, coconut oil or other natural ingredients when treating specific issues. It's important to ask a doctor about the guidelines for adding anything extra to your sitz bath based on the condition you're attempting to treat. Uses for a Sitz Bath

   A sitz bath can be used any time there is pain, discomfort or irritation. However, it is especially beneficial for some specific issues related to female health. Take a look at common uses for a sitz bath.

Vaginal Yeast Infection 

   A sitz bath can be helpful in treating inflammation caused by a yeast infection. Many women find that sensations of swelling, burning, and itching are subdued a bit after taking sitz baths. A sitz bath can be a great tool for pain relief while waiting for medication to begin working. 

Hemorrhoids

   It can be difficult to get relief from painful hemorrhoids if you sit at a desk all day. Those suffering from hemorrhoids often experience irritation, itching, pain or bleeding. A sitz bath can provide soothing relief for these symptoms because it takes the pressure off the impacted area. 

Anal Fissures 

   A sitz bath is often recommended for little tears that form in the thin lining of the anus. In addition to causing pain, fissures can cause spasms in your anal sphincter. The benefit of a sitz bath is that it may help to relax the anal sphincter. This often helps to heal a fissure faster because constant spasms can repeatedly crack fissures open.

Postoperative and Postpartum Recovery

   Sitz baths are often recommended for relief following surgeries for removing hemorrhoids or draining cysts. In addition to being therapeutic, a sitz bath may also help to keep wounds clean following an operation. Many women also find that sitz baths help to reduce pain and inflammation following vaginal delivery. It's going to be important to get permission from your physician before enjoying a sitz bath following any type of medical procedure.
